Objectives and Contextualisation

The objective of this module is to learn about the different contexts of mediation (field of private law), its legal regulations and the specific actions required in the different fields of civil and commercial private law to avoid the initiation of a judicial or commercial dispute, or favor the transaction. Likewise, it is also intended to acquire skills to know how to carry out and develop a mediation process applied to the areas of private law.

Content

The following content blocks will be taught:
 
  • Mediation as a process of intervention and conflict management in the context of citizen coexistence, communities, organizations, family businesses, foundations and associations, and other areas of private law linked to socio-educational aspects.
  • The typology of conflicts in the areas of private law.
  • Areas and specificities of private law and possible object of mediation.
  • Methodology, stages and preparation of the mediation process applied to the areas of private law.
  • Notions about the basic legal regulation related to mediation in the areas of private law: basic legal content, legal effects of mediation, and commercial mediation.

We opt for continuous evaluation, progress and sequential delivery. During the development of the module, evaluable activities of collaborative work will be carried out, through attendance, active participation in Forums and analysis of the thematic conferences of experts in mediation, also through the thematic exhibition and delivery of exercises/cases specific; on the other hand, individual work activities, such as the completion of the thematic report of the module and the development test.

* To pass the module, it is required to obtain a grade higher than 50% in the evaluable activities.
 
** Copying or plagiarism, in any type of assessment test, constitutes a crime, and will be penalized with a 0 as a grade for the subject, losing the possibility of recovering it. A work or activitywill be considered "copied" when it reproduces all or a significant part of the work of another colleague. A work or activity will be considered "plagiarized" when a part of an author's text is presented as one's own without citing the sources, regardless of whether the original sources are on paper or in digital format. https://wuster.uab.es/web_argumenta_obert/unit_20/sot_2_01.html
